- President Trump indicated Iran should be allowed a nuclear program for electricity, a shift from earlier demands for 'zero enrichment' during the war.
- Trump's comments were made at the G7 summit, where he called the restriction on Iran's nuclear access 'a little tough' and urged 'common sense'.
- The change in stance could lead to a final peace deal without nuclear restrictions, potentially weaker than the 2015 JCPOA agreement.
- The JCPOA was a multilateral agreement involving UN Security Council members and the EU, whereas Trump's deal was negotiated without congressional awareness.
- Iran is expected to receive $300 billion in reconstruction funds, raising questions about the Trump administration's accomplishments in the war.
